Well I'm Runing. I have made only 23 km, after I left the garage and drove only 5 km I got a terrible fright when the car stops, suddenly in the exit of the highway and wont strat, even the starter engine did not work. The police tow the car to honda again. I was thinking the Worst: I blew the enigne becase something was not good. The problem was the battery, so I decided to get a new one to avoid any fright again.
Iincreased the fuel the pressure to 60 psi and shift at 3.500 rpm and never pass the 50% of Throttle posistion until I get the new injectors (440 cc) and finish the break in process
Air fuel ratio is 14-15, mostly 14.5, doing this type of driving.
the 9th of May Sean is comming to Spain to tune it with the AEM
